USI President Resigns

category national | miscellaneous | news report author Saturday October 13, 2007 17:55author by USIOB - USIauthor email usiob at gmail dot com Report this post to the editors

Morrisroe loses confidence vote

Right-Wing USI President Richie Morrisroe was today forced from office in an uprising sparked by a memo leaked by a fellow officer during the week.

This is a victory for the left and for student activism.

Don't know anything about the current kerfuffle, but in the late 1960s through the 'seventies USI was a stomping ground for a couple of people who later became prominent in SFWP.

The big clever move was in the mid-sixties when USI Travel was formed and became a big moneyspinner by selling lots of cheap flight and train tickets. Students could globetrot on the cheap. Lots flew to Amerikay, did summer jobs, then saw America on Greyhound bus trips.

Taking a year off degree studies to be president of USI brought a salary and useful work experience to put on the personal CV - good for entry to glam career areas, RTE included. Would be interesting if a researcher could track each USI president since mid-sixties and see where their career and/or political trajectory led.

Small footnote: Vincent Browne cut his teeth in a national current affairs monthly that received financial help from USI (anybody remember the title? It had a famous cover after the Battle of the Bogside in 1969 with the banner headline NO BOTTLES NO RIGHTS. The mag folded some months after Browne paid lots of lolly for the right to print grim photos of the Mai Lai massacre in Vietnam. Soon after he went on to found Magill, with money from different sources. Browne's juvenile enthusiasm was for the FG Young Tigers, never for SFWP.

Magill mag carried articles on the stickies in the eighties in which the USI dimension to WP influence was mentioned.
